Although not a GIS, Microstation is a specialist CAD package and has far
superior Cartographic abilities than MapInfo.
There is an Intergraph plotting utility for Microstation called iplot that
allows total control of your out-put prints by writing a "pen table" to
control line weights, colors, fills, etc .... (and text/labels stay where
you put them).
We do our "high end" mapping in Microstation and corporate project analysis
in MGE. MapInfo is used for desktop analysis and users produce field maps
and some basic maps for reports.

Conversion of graphics from MI to Microstation (and back the other way) is
achieved by exporting to .dxf and then importing the .dxf into Microstation.
There are a couple of alternatives to this like the m2d and d2m utilities
available from the MI ftp site or FME. I haven't had much joy converting MI
tab to Microstation dgn in New Zealand Map Grid using MapInfo's Universal
Translator from MI v5.0, it brings the graphics in, but warps and offsets
the linework. Strange.

Here is a fairly broad question:  Graphically speaking, what are the
differences between Microstation and MapInfo?  The reason I am asking is
because our city is currently exploring the issue of utilizing one base map
throughout.  Right now, we have several "base maps" floating around the
city.  Some are created and maintained in Microstation, others in MapInfo.
The accuracy of each is questionable, but that is a different issue.  In
short, which software produces the best presentation quality maps?  I have
no experience with Microstation, and I am only a one-month user of MapInfo.
I thought I could pose this question in this forum in hopes that there is
someone out there who has experience with both softwares.  Any insight would
be helpful!
